From April 23 to 28, 2026, an international scientific field expedition was conducted in Tajikistan to study the biodiversity and ecological condition of meadow ecosystems in different natural and climatic zones of the country. The research was carried out with the participation of scientists from the Xinjiang Institute of Ecology and Geography, Northeast Normal University, and the Institute of Botany, Plant Physiology and Genetics, with coordination and support from the Research Center for Ecology and Environment of Central Asia.

From 11 to 14 September 2025, researchers of the Research Centre for Ecology and Environment of Central Asia took part in research in the area of Lake Sarez and its upper reaches (Rushan and Murghab districts of GBAO) in a joint expedition with representatives of the Committee for Emergency Situations and Civil Defense of the Government of the Republic of Tajikistan and the Main Department of Geology under the Government of the Republic of Tajikistan with the support of the Aga Khan Habitat Agency.

From August 29 to September 2, 2025, the Center's employees conducted a study and monitoring of the state of glaciers and glacial lakes in the Surkhob River basin. In the course of field research, aerial photography of the tongue part of the Said Nafisi glacier, where several small glacial lakes are located, was carried out using unmanned aerial vehicles. Glacial lakes in mountainous areas pose a serious danger.
